I wanted to see price lose H4 EMA9 and set up long into H4 EMA50, which aligns perfectly with D1 EMA9. The latter has to lead if buyers want higher immediately. Sellers are trying to break lower - notice how price is backtesting the lost trend diagonal. Buyers remain in control until D1 EMA21 is lost, but we have the first hints of that classic wedge shape that governs these contractions.
We don’t need a lot of buyers. We just need a few to run the stops of speculators that are short because we’re at the .618 and the crash is next. My system is clear: the weekly breakdown failed, and although price may look for a higher low towards last week’s low, right here, the setup is long. Short only if it fails.
We now have a D1 EMA9 consolidation and we’re three days in. We have two inside days, with the daily about to confirm a buy signal.
